Sophie's Australian Research Council DECRA Fellowship (DE180100440)
This project aims to develop a new steel processing technology that will simultaneously increase strength and ductility via multi-scale hierarchical microstructures. Specifically, ultra-fine grain sized steels will be produced with controlled precipitation, segregation and solute atom clustering. Atom probe crystallography will be used to study the structure and chemistry of grain boundaries, providing new insights into the toughness of structural steels. The expected outcome will be the identification of potential new manufacturing routes for future high strength low alloy steels that are stronger, more ductile, and safer.
